Marmot Halo 6-Person Tent

January 10, 2012

like the specs say, you will have approx 100+/- Sq.Ft. of "usable space". with this tent you also have the additional storage area in the vestibule area. i have spent time in one however i own mountain hardware and TNF tents. with this tent, it is cool how the poles actually push outward, giving even a bit more room. one thing i would have wanted would be more gear loops inside. hope this helps.

Mountain Hardy

Mountain Hardwear Trango 3.1 Tent 3-Person 4-Season

Rating for this product: 4 January 21, 2011

This tent is made for the cold. Super insulated and huge for two people. Great gear loops and baskets for storing gear, and keeping things close for a 3am bathroom break. The only problem, and the reason its not quite perfect, are the stakes. I know M-H is trying to keep weight to a minimum but the steak "fitting" portion is very small and the tent loops can come undone if the tension loosens a bit. Otherwise a great addition to add to your arsenal!

Super Solid!!

Millet Radikal Speed Shoe - Men's

Millet Radikal Speed Shoe - Men's

Rating for this product: 5 December 20, 2010

Really Great Design! Vibram soles are very well balanced and hold the upper portion of the shoe in place. Little bit stiff out of the box but break in after about 10 hours. BOA lacing system works really well on steep climbs. Overall great shoe. Little Pricey but overall quality makes up for it.
